Abstract
The H Shape Toothbrush is for the daily use of cleaning teeth. Its toothbrush head is in H shape. Inside the H shape toothbrush head, brushes extend inward facing the top, front and back of teeth as well as gums on both top and bottom jaw. During tooth brushing, it cleans all surfaces of the teeth and cleans/massages gums at same time in every stroke, which makes it very efficient. It minimizes the hard to reach areas on the back of teeth for the ordinary toothbrush, which makes it more effective on tooth cleaning. Elastic materials are used to allow the toothbrush head deforming to fit with teeth of different sizes. 8 humps are designed inside the H shape toothbrush head to control the deformation. A toothbrush handle is designed that it can rotate with respect to the H shape toothbrush head for convenient use.

FIGS. 1-10 are used to describe the invention. Those Figures are simple, straightforward and self-explanatory. References to those FIGs are listed here as the description of the invention. - 1. The H Shape Toothbrush comprises a H shape toothbrush head and a toothbrush handle as shown in
FIGS. 1 , 3, 6, 7, 8 and 9. - 2. The toothbrush handle is assembled onto the H shape toothbrush head through a toothbrush handle assembly which allows the toothbrush handle to rotate with respect to the H shape toothbrush head as shown in
FIGS. 1 , 3, 6, 7 and 8. - 3. The H shape toothbrush head comprises 3 elastic material parts and 5 hard plastic parts. 2 elastic material parts connect the 5 hard plastic parts together to form a H shape toothbrush head with elasticity. Another elastic material part connects the H shape toothbrush head with the toothbrush handle assembly. The 5 hard plastic parts have brushes extending inward from their inner surfaces of the H shape toothbrush head facing the top, front and back of teeth on both top and bottom jaw.
- 4. The H shape toothbrush head has 8 humps on the inner surfaces of 2 hard plastic parts for controlling the deformation of the U shape toothbrush head. The locations of the 8 humps are shown most clearly in
FIGS. 10A , 10B and 10C. - 5.
FIGS. 10A , 10B and 10C also illustrates the H shape toothbrush head following the tooth profile and deforming to fit teeth of different sizes through using elastic material and hump design. -

Claims (4)
1. A H Shape Toothbrush comprising:
a H shape toothbrush head with a rotational toothbrush handle the toothbrush handle is assembled onto the H shape toothbrush head through a toothbrush handle assembly, which allows the toothbrush handle to rotate with respect to the H shape toothbrush head
the H shape toothbrush head further comprises 3 elastic material parts and 5 hard plastic parts,
the 2 elastic material parts connect the 5 hard plastic parts together to form a H shape toothbrush head with elasticity,
another elastic material part connects the H shape toothbrush head with the toothbrush handle assembly base to give the H shape toothbrush head the freedom to deform,
the 4 hard plastic parts have brushes extending inward facing the front and back of teeth and gums,
another hard plastic part has brushes extending out from both its top and bottom surfaces facing the top of the teeth on both top and bottom jaw,
the H shape toothbrush head also has 8 humps on the inner surfaces of 4 hard plastic parts for controlling the deformation of the H shape toothbrush head to fit the teeth of different sizes.
2. The H Shape Toothbrush of claim 1 , wherein said with the H shape toothbrush head and brushes extending inward from 3 directions facing the top, front and back of teeth as well as gums on both top and bottom jaw, when it is used during tooth brushing, it cleans the top, front and back of teeth and cleans/massages the gums at same time in every brushing stroke.
3. The H Shape Toothbrush of claim 1 , wherein said using elastic material and hump designs to give the H shape toothbrush head the elasticity to deform to fit teeth of different sizes when the H shape toothbrush head move along teeth following the tooth profile.
4. The H Shape Toothbrush of claim 1 , wherein said the toothbrush handle is assembled onto the H shape toothbrush head through a toothbrush handle assembly base. The toothbrush handle can rotate with respect to the H shape toothbrush head for convenient use.
